What will be expected of you:
Floors
- Floor maintenance via daily use of brush, water, and diluted chemicals
- Use of automatic floor scrubber once a week in order to maintain tile grout
- Buffer, vacuum, polish floors
- Removal and pressure washing of floor mats
Bathrooms
- Cleaning shower walls and floor
- Metal hardware polishing
Amenities
- Replenishing of towels and all other amenities
Sinks
- Constant cleaning/drying/ of sinks and glass or mirrored surfaces not limited to times of high member traffic
- Polishing of sink hardware toilet, etc.
- Towel removal from all bathrooms
- Replenishing of soap, toilet paper, paper towels and other amenities
- Realign furniture according to floor plan.
- Inspect condition of all furniture for tears, rips or stains; report any damages to maintenance.
- Update status of rooms cleaned on assignment sheet and with the front desk.
- Report any guest room damages or maintenance issues to supervisor or front desk in the absence of supervisor.
- Ensure guest complaints are resolved, ensuring guest satisfaction, report all incidents to supervisor or front desk.
- Assist in maintaining the cleanliness of the laundry room
- The ability to operate a two-way radio, cleaning and general office equipment, including a computer, is expected. This position requires continuous movement and standing, and the ability to lift up to 50 pounds
- Ability to work weekends, holidays, AM and PM shifts
